Govt likely to rework uplinking guidelines
Wednesday, August 20 2003 17:58 Hrs (IST)

New Delhi: Dissatisfied with Star's application for uplinking its news channel from India, government is likely to rework the uplinking guidelines to ensure its strict compliance.

The first meeting of the Group of Ministers (GoM) comprising Finance Minister Jaswant Singh, Law Minister Arun Jaitley and Information and Broadcasting Minister Ravi Shankar Prasad was held on August 20.

The GoM is likely to meet soon and take a final decision on the matter, sources said.
